Title: Hardenability of steel (Jominy-end quench)

Objective: To understand mechanism of hardenability in steels by Jominy-end quench method.

Equipments: Heat treatment furnaces and Rockwell hardness machine

Specimen: 4340 steels (0.4%C, 0.8%Cr, 1.8%Ni, 0.25%Mo)

Procedures: Samples have been heat treated using the following conditions: Austenitizing at about 900oC for 30 minutes, water spray from one end until the whole samples cooled down to room temperature (about 10 minutes). The sample is then ground/polish to remove the scales/oxide. Hardness test- (Rockwell) is performed on the flat area with a distance of about 5 mm from one indentation to another.
